Job description
- Manage case queues: Handle requests and issues in software programs, ensuring timely resolution.
- Participate in bridge calls: Address high severity issues and be available for urgent situations.
- Design monitoring frameworks: Develop and maintain dashboards for actionable insights into application performance.
- Monitor alerts: Resolve platform performance issues using synthetic monitoring alerts and other tools.
- Track customer-reported bugs: Use issue tracking systems to manage and resolve bugs.
- Project ownership: Ensure timely communication of updates and progress to internal teams.
- Customer triage sessions: Address technical issues with customers and provide solutions.
- Document triage steps: Create knowledge base entries for future reference and training.
- Weekend Coverage: Provide weekend coverage as part of an established operational schedule.
